Go to the source code of this file.
|
ConditionPtrs | cftMakeRepeatedConditions () |
|
| TEST (ConditionFilterTester, construction_zeroconditions) |
|
| TEST (ConditionFilterTester, construction_onecondition) |
|
| TEST (ConditionFilterTester, zerojets_zeroconditions) |
|
| TEST (ConditionFilterTester, zerojets_onecondition) |
|
| TEST (ConditionFilterTester, twojets_zeroconditions) |
|
| TEST (ConditionFilterTester, twojets_onecondition) |
|
◆ cftMakeRepeatedConditions()
◆ TEST() [1/6]
TEST |
( |
ConditionFilterTester |
, |
|
|
construction_onecondition |
|
|
) |
| |
◆ TEST() [2/6]
TEST |
( |
ConditionFilterTester |
, |
|
|
construction_zeroconditions |
|
|
) |
| |
◆ TEST() [3/6]
TEST |
( |
ConditionFilterTester |
, |
|
|
twojets_onecondition |
|
|
) |
| |
Definition at line 115 of file ConditionFilterTest.cxx.
119 std::unique_ptr<ITrigJetHypoInfoCollector> deb(
nullptr);
121 std::vector<double> jet_eta{1.0, 0.5, 2.0, 4.0};
124 auto fj =
filter.filter(tv, deb);
125 EXPECT_EQ(fj.size(), 2
u);
127 auto etas = std::vector<double> {};
128 etas.reserve(fj.size());
131 std::back_inserter(
etas),
132 [](
const pHypoJet& hj){return hj->eta();});
135 EXPECT_EQ(
etas.size(), 2
u);
136 EXPECT_DOUBLE_EQ(
etas[0], 0.5);
137 EXPECT_DOUBLE_EQ(
etas[1], 1.0);
◆ TEST() [4/6]
TEST |
( |
ConditionFilterTester |
, |
|
|
twojets_zeroconditions |
|
|
) |
| |
Definition at line 82 of file ConditionFilterTest.cxx.
86 std::unique_ptr<ITrigJetHypoInfoCollector> deb(
nullptr);
87 std::vector<double> jet_eta{1.0, 0.5, 2.0, 4.0};
90 EXPECT_EQ(tv.size(), 4
u);
92 auto fj =
filter.filter(tv, deb);
93 EXPECT_EQ(fj.size(), 4
u);
106 double f_eta = fj.front()->eta();
107 double s_eta = fj.back()->eta();
109 EXPECT_EQ(f_eta, tv.front()->eta());
110 EXPECT_EQ(s_eta, tv.back()->eta());
◆ TEST() [5/6]
TEST |
( |
ConditionFilterTester |
, |
|
|
zerojets_onecondition |
|
|
) |
| |
Definition at line 69 of file ConditionFilterTest.cxx.
76 std::unique_ptr<ITrigJetHypoInfoCollector> deb(
nullptr);
78 auto fj =
filter.filter(tv, deb);
79 EXPECT_EQ(fj.size(), 0
u);
◆ TEST() [6/6]
TEST |
( |
ConditionFilterTester |
, |
|
|
zerojets_zeroconditions |
|
|
) |
| |
Definition at line 58 of file ConditionFilterTest.cxx.
62 std::unique_ptr<ITrigJetHypoInfoCollector> deb(
nullptr);
64 auto fj = rf.filter(tv, deb);
65 EXPECT_EQ(fj.size(), 0
u);
◆ ATLAS_NO_CHECK_FILE_THREAD_SAFETY
ATLAS_NO_CHECK_FILE_THREAD_SAFETY |
void sort(typename std::reverse_iterator< DataModel_detail::iterator< DVL > > beg, typename std::reverse_iterator< DataModel_detail::iterator< DVL > > end, const Compare &comp)
Specialization of sort for DataVector/List.